Myrtle Alexander Obituary

Myrtle Alexander was born March 5th, 1943, to the parents of Theodore Jackson and Marilyn Mack Smith in Fort Worth, Texas. Sister Alexander accepted the Lord Jesus Christ as her personal Savior at an early age and was baptized under the leadership of Pastor J.E. Pettie. She retained a faithful membership at Freshly Anointed Baptist Church under the leadership of Reverend Doctor G.L Durham. She would attend church every Sunday, and in her words “If the good Lord let me see it”, she would be there.
Myrtle aka Little Sister, known by her immediate family attended James E. Guinn Elementary and I.M. Terrel High School in Fort Worth Independent School District. She further continued her education by completing courses at Tarrant County Junior College for Dietary Services for Nursing Homes and Nursing Administration. She had a career in food preparation and distribution at Long Term Care facilities and worked as a Dietary Manager until her retirement.
She met and married R. C Alexander aka Uncle Charles in 1962 until they divorced in 1983. In 1989 she met John Mitchell Jr aka JR and was united in holy matrimony by Pastor J. E. Pettie. Sister Alexander liked to shop, travel, and visit family. She also enjoyed studying the Bible, listening to Gospel music, and making black-eyed peas for new year’s. She found joy in talking with friends and encouraging them from her heart with a smile and laughter that would brighten their day. Her favorite color was lavender, and she looked beautiful in it.
She is preceded in death by her parents, first husband, R.C Alexander, Aunt Pearl Nelson aka Maw-maw, her loving sister Alice Faye Rancifer, niece Donna Rancifer, and great-nephews Derrick, David, and Eric.
Myrtle Alexander entered her eternal rest on June 6th, 2022. She leaves to cherish her memories, her loving son Deaunte (Bubba) Vaughn, husband John Mitchell Jr., nieces Wanda Mack, Tracy Toussaint (Michael), Victoria Rancifer, Danielle Rancifer, nephew David Rancifer, and a host of great-nieces, nephews, family, and friends.
